PEEL KATHERINE At the age of 99, Katherine Feduska Peel passed away quietly on March 3, 2015. She was born in Leetsdale, PA. One of 12 children of Michael and Anna Mahnick Feduska, Katherine was a hard working person with a keen wit and an interest in sports and politics. At the age of 16, she was hired as a nursemaid to the Snowden family in Sewickley, PA, and during WWII she worked at the National Electric Company in Ambridge where she met her late husband, Jack Peel. After raising two children, she returned to school and earned her high school diploma. Katherine had a talent for music and art, and she was a wonderful cook and baker who always made holidays a special time for her extended family. Katherine is survived by her daughter, Lois Ann Peel Eisenstein; and son, Jack Daniel Peel; grandchildren, Erica Eisenstein Lynett, Jesse Daniel Peel, and Zachary Robert Peel; and great-grandchildren, Idefix Liljequist Peel, Evan Joseph Lynett, and Julianne Lois Lynett.
